BOZ ponders phasing out cheque books

THE Bank of Zambia is pondering phasing out the use of cheques as a payment instrument, effective December 31, 2025. According to a notice issued yesterday, BOZ stated that the decision was necessitated by a sustained decrease in cheque usage by members of the public and businesses. “In line with the National Payment System Vision…...

External debt has increased from $13.04bn to $14.7bn since we took over – Musokotwane

FINANCE Minister Dr Situmbeko Musokotwane has explained that Zambia’s external debt has increased from $13.04 billion to $14.7 billion, while domestic debt has risen from K194 billion to K225 billion since the UPND took over government in 2021.
